Unsure btw what you talk about. Surprised How its weak? Shocked AR has a number of strong features already:
Deal Mineral fountain late game.
Deal Immunity to pop-dropping.
Deal Immunity to packets.
Deal Little colonies have good resources.
Deal Big breeders grow lots of pop even at lower racial growth rates like 14%.
Deal No investing into planetary facilities.
Deal Colony capacity is not limited by its value.

Just for a record: Bigger games (i consider medium universe big)i have been in were won by AR, SD or IS; Smaller games were mostly won by JOAT or IT monsters. Other PRT-s are been less successful. Nod

Part of the reason people consider it "weak" is they don't think about evacuating all but 100 colonists before a fight at their planet - so even if they lost the starbase, if they control orbit they could just recolonize the next turn and have their planet back. if they don't control orbit, they can shift the colonists off somewhere else to produce resources until the orbit is clear and they can recolonize.

You don't have as many total resources, but those resources are all available for research, terraforming, and shipbuilding. You don't have to spend anything on ramping factories.
Keep in mind that the more evenly spread (taking hab% into account) your population is, the more total resources you get.
And it's much quicker and easier to toss together a Death Star and gate in some midgetminers than to build 1700 factories and 1700 mines.
Don't rely on the stations to defend themselves. Intercept your enemies in space.
